The extra half I chose to take
To save myself for my own self’s sake
Its added weight appeared to lighten
The deepest darkness seemed to brighten
But as time passed I began to feel
That parts of me this cure would steal
My sense of touch, my sight, my taste
Even my love would dissipate
It’s true that piece removed some doom
But what is gained when I cannot move?
Though in lightness I may suffer
At least I myself can try to buffer.
So I reject you half, I won’t oblige
I will not let you take my eyes.
Wrest no more control from me;
With my own lungs the air I breathe.
